What if the strongest culture strategies aren't crafted in boardrooms, but in breakrooms, maintenance closets, and one-on-one hallway conversations?
In this episode, Amy Lynn Durham is joined by Todd Wuestenberg, Chief Culture Officer at Haverkamp Properties, to explore how culture becomes tangible when ordinary people are empowered to create extraordinary impact.
Drawing from his agricultural roots and over two decades in leadership, Todd offers a grounded, people-first perspective on building cultures that truly care.
